On 2005-12-03 13:37, Kono wrote:
To muddle things up even more I checked with Merriam-Webster online and they have the pronunciation as: Pronunciation: 'or-"zhä(t)

The "t" is in parentheses but if you click on the listening icon the guy pronounces it with a definite "t" on the end.

http://www.m-w.com/dictionary/orgeat

That listening is not exactly the correct prononciation. You don't have to say the "t" at the end. And the zhä is more soft than that, but I'm sorry I can't find an english prononciation for it. The zhä is something more like "jah"
